Where can I find out what trailers can handle what size of rocks that won't jack it up? Like, what size rock can you use in an aluminum trailer, steel trailer, reinforced steel trailer?

Most guys won't put antything bigger than 6' erosion stone in a aluminum trailer with a liner.......

3-5 inch rip rap will hurt even a steel rock bucket, but is doable. Would prefer a demo trailer for anything that big. Biggest we put in an aluminum is bull rock. And they still need to take it easy loading.
